Clerks of the Assembly
The Chair is interested in appointing a number of clerks to assist in presiding votes and participate in the internal administration of the Assembly.
There are two qualifications to be considered for appointment as clerk:
-
Be a legislator with a clear record of active and good faith participation in the Assembly
-
Have never held an office subject to election or Assembly confirmation
The Chair is responsible for making all final decisions on the appointment and dismissal of clerks.
Clerks will be responsible for:
-
Opening or closing votes according to the rotation schedule set by the Chair.
-
Participating in internal discussions with the Chair and fellow clerks on the administration of the Assembly.
-
Presiding over Caucus Days.
-
Performing other administrative duties as directed by the Chair.
